Washing Machine Quit Mid Cycle. having a productive laundry day and your washer stops mid cycle? Follow this guide to determine how to fix the problem, including info for both top & front loading machines. A washer that senses an unbalanced load will prevent itself from spinning fast, as that will cause the drum to hit itself. There could be a problem with the power source, the load could be unbalanced, the lid switch or door lock might be bad, the drain hose could be clogged, the water inlet valve might be blocked or defective, the timer is malfunctioning, the pump and/or motor may be bad, or. there are several reasons a washing machine stops before the spin cycle.
